Hen Cove Beach is a tranquil and family-friendly destination located in Pocasset, Bourne, Massachusetts. It offers a wide expanse of sand and calm, protected waters, making it perfect for swimming and relaxation. The beach features a roped-off swimming area and lifeguards on duty, ensuring a safe environment for children. Visitors can enjoy the scenic views across the cove and explore nearby trails that lead through sandy pine barrens to a salt marsh overlooking Pocasset Heights.

The beach is also known for its diverse wildlife, including herons, ospreys, and egrets in the summer, and eiders and buffleheads in the winter. The nearby boat ramp allows for easy access to the water for boating enthusiasts.

Hen Cove Beach is a secluded spot, ideal for those seeking a peaceful day at the shore without the crowds often found at more popular Cape Cod beaches.

Hen Cove Beach provides basic amenities such as portable toilets, but it lacks showers and picnic areas. However, the nearby trails offer scenic walks and opportunities to explore the natural surroundings. For those interested in water activities, a boat ramp is available just down the street, allowing easy access for boating and fishing. The beach itself is well-suited for swimming and sunbathing, with lifeguards present during peak hours to ensure safety.

While the beach does not offer rental equipment, its calm waters make it an ideal spot for families to enjoy swimming and playing in the sand.

Hen Cove Beach is perfect for swimming and sunbathing due to its calm and protected waters. Visitors can also enjoy walking along the beach and exploring the nearby trails that lead through sandy pine barrens to a salt marsh. The beach is not ideal for surfing due to its calm conditions, but it is great for families looking to spend a peaceful day by the water. For those interested in boating, the nearby boat ramp provides easy access to the cove.

Wildlife enthusiasts can enjoy spotting a variety of bird species throughout the year, including herons and ospreys in the summer and eiders in the winter.

Parking at Hen Cove Beach is limited and typically requires a town-issued sticker, which can be obtained by residents or visitors staying in Bourne. This policy helps maintain the beach's peaceful atmosphere and ensures that it remains accessible primarily to local residents and those with a connection to the area. The beach's secluded nature means that parking spaces are not abundant, so visitors should plan accordingly.

Hen Cove Beach is known for its rich wildlife, including a variety of bird species that visit throughout the year. The beach's calm waters make it an ideal spot for families with small children. Historically, the area has been significant for shellfishing, although quahogging is not permitted directly at the beach. The nearby Sand Spit is a popular spot for clam digging with a town permit.

The beach's tranquil atmosphere and scenic views across the cove make it a peaceful retreat from the more crowded Cape Cod beaches.

Near Hen Cove Beach, visitors can explore the scenic trails that lead through sandy pine barrens to a salt marsh overlooking Pocasset Heights. The Cape Cod Canal, which bisects the town of Bourne, is another nearby attraction, offering superb sports fishing and the opportunity to watch ships from around the world pass through. The Bourne Scenic Park campground, located beneath the Bourne Bridge, provides a picturesque spot for camping and enjoying the canal views.

For those interested in history, the nearby village of Gray Gables, where President Grover Cleveland once spent his summer vacations, offers a glimpse into the past.
